Ronnie had cleaned up his act a bit by the time Gaines joined the band … “That Smell” was a message on one level to Gary Rossington who hadn’t .., and he was so impressed by Gaines’ talent that he brought him into his orbit as a collaborator in a way that he never did with the others. That’s the saddest what if, what they might have produced.
